Christmas tree takes root at City Hall

This year's City Hall Christmas tree went up Sunday morning. Nov. 8, 2015. Colton Goforth/ Global News

WINNIPEG — This year’s City Hall Christmas tree has arrived.

The 40-foot Colorado blue spruce went up Sunday morning.

It was donated by a homeowner in the Maples area.

A city crew will begin decorating the tree over the next several days with over 9,000 lights.  The ceremonial lighting takes place later this month.
